$\mathrm{HNO}_{3}$ (aq) is titrated with $\mathrm{NaOH}(\mathrm{aq})$ conductometrically, graphical representation of the titration is :
Solution
Molar conductivity of $\mathrm{H}^{+}$ and $\mathrm{OH}^{-}$ are very high as compare to other ions. Initially conductance of solution sharply decreases due to consumption of free $\mathrm{H}^{+}$. After complete neutralization further slightly increases due to presence of $\mathrm{OH}^{-}$.
